KEYSTONE BLOCK

The number on retaining walling system on the market today. Keystone uses a unique high strength fixing system which securely locks the component parts in place. At the centre of the system are pultruded fibreglass pins which offer a high shear strength that will last the lifetime of the wall.
Keystone provides design flexibility to meet the unique challenges of modern commercial development projects; whether you are building tall retaining walls, short walls, using curves or corners, considering rapid changes in elevation detail or using Keystone with other specialist materials.
This proven system enhances the architectural importance of any structure whether new-build or refurbishment.

The fill material typically falls within the general guidelines of 6I/6J as per the Specification for Highway Works and is deemed to be a well or uniformly graded granular material.
A gravity Keystone wall can be built up to around 1m. Employing the use of Insitu concrete behind the wall can increase this height up to approximately 1.8m.
The grid length is typically around 0.7 times the height of the wall however the minimum grid length to comply with BS 8006 is 3m.
The BBA certificate held by Anderton Concrete is based upon the use of Tensar 500 series grids. Other grids can be used behind a Keystone wall but this would be at the designer’s discretion and they would need to ensure that the use of a different grid complies with all the relevant regulations.
The normal design for a reinforced earth wall has a 300mm zone directly behind the wall formed from a 4-20mm angular drainage stone feeding into a drainage pipe at the bottom that leads to the site drainage system
